John Gardner has created a powerful human piece from the monster's point of view. Grendel is the evil monster slayed by Beowulf. But in John Gardner's book, Grendel is the protagonist and the reader sees the story from his eyes. Grendel at the end of chapter ten sums up the whole hypocrisy in a simple phrase. "A stupid business." ;(Gardner 150) Difference of Character Development in Beowulf and Grendel The main difference between the Anglo-Saxon poem, Beowulf, and John Gardner's modern retelling, Grendel, lies in the development of the characters.

About John Gardner. John Gardner received wide acclaim for his novels, his collections of short stories, and his critical works. He was born in Batavia, New York, in 1933, and taught English, Anglo-Saxon, and creative writing at Oberlin College, Chico State College, San… More about John Gardner
